Webpack集成Symfony项目的好帮手——webpack-bundle
1. 项目基础介绍
webpack-bundle
是一个开源项目,旨在帮助开发者将 Webpack 集成到 Symfony 框架中。该项目主要使用 PHP 编程语言,通过提供一系列的Bundle和工具,使得Webpack的配置和管理工作在Symfony环境中变得更加简单和高效。
2. 核心功能
- 自动寻找Twig模板中的JavaScript入口点:
webpack-bundle
能够自动识别Twig模板中的JavaScript入口点,并运行Webpack来处理这些文件。 - 资产路径管理:它保存了生成的文件名,确保Twig函数返回正确的资产URL。
- 开发环境支持:在开发环境中,它可以运行
webpack-dev-server
,实时监听文件变化并重新生成资产。 - 灵活的配置:允许用户自定义Webpack配置,同时提供了从Symfony获取必要的参数,如入口点、别名等。
- 支持多种文件类型:原生支持图片和CSS/LESS/SCSS文件的处理。
- 兼容性:同时支持Webpack 2和Webpack 1。
3. 最近更新的功能
由于项目详情中没有提供最近的更新日志,我无法准确列出最近更新的功能。通常,项目的更新可能包括以下内容:
- 性能优化
- Bug修复
- 新功能的添加
- 兼容性更新
- 文档的改进
建议关注项目的GitHub仓库以获取最新的更新信息。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考